Boer War Memorial unveiling, Haverfordwest, South Wales
Commemorative photograph of the unveiling of the Boer War Memorial at St Mary the Virgin Church, High Street, Haverfordwest, Pembrokeshire, Dyfed, South Wales. The memorial is surrounded by local dignitaries, clergy, a police band and crowds of townspeople. The various umbrellas show that it was a wet day. The memorial is in the form of a celtic cross and was made from Cornish granite, with 44 names of Pembrokeshire men listed on it. It was unveiled by Lord Cawdor
